About

Sinead Anne Rafferty is a litigation attorney with 18 years of legal experience, practicing at Law Offices of Sinead Rafferty, LLC in Madison, CT. He earned a degree from Choate Rosemary Hall in 1997, a B.S. from Vanderbilt University in 2001, and a J.D. from Quinnipiac School of Law in 2006. He is admitted to practice in New York (since 2007) and Connecticut (since 2006). His practice encompasses litigation, health care, and medical malpractice,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
